I have about 48 hours in Iceland until I leave for Amsterdam.

I'm staying with a friend in Reykjavik, but I want to get a great shot before I leave.

I have no car, but willing to spend up to 20.000isk to get around.

What should I do?
05/28/2014 02:33:41 PM · #2
A Golden Circle tour is about the best thing you can do with one day. (Plenty of other operators do it as well.) The off-the-beaten-path types may scoff, but it's definitely the best use of your time for one day without a car.
